2020 IRP REGISTRATION BY STATE This will determine the cost per apportioned vehicle. For example, at a combined weight of 80,000 pounds and a total of 25,000 (25%) miles traveled in Ohio, the Ohio IRP apportioned fee would be $335. Or 25% of the annual fee ($1,340). To put it simply, the International Fuel Tax Agreement (IFTA) is a pact between the lower 48 states and the ten Canadian provinces that requires all interstate motor carriers to report fuel taxes. One of the advantages of the IRP is that vehicles need only be registered once with the base state. The apportioned plate allows drivers to operate in any jurisdiction. Registration fees are paid to the IRP office in the base state and are distributed according to mileage accrued in each state. You may need aUSDOT number.

WHAT DO YOU NEED TO KNOW A truck broker, also known as a freight broker, is the middle man. He’s in an agreement between a shipper who has goods to transport and a carrier who has the ability to move the load. Renewing Your North Dakota IRP Plate. Your IRP North Dakota plate is valid for one year only. About 90 days before the renewal due date, the IRP office will send you a notification packet that contains all the information you’ll need. Keep in mind that your renewal application must be received by the IRP at least 30 days prior to thedue date.

WHAT IS IFTA AND WHY IT'S IMPORTANT Drivers report mileage to their base state only, which in turn takes care of distributing the taxes among the jurisdictions on that driver’s route. This process saves everyone a great deal of time, paperwork, and headaches. Of course, there are other reasons why the IFTA is important to the trucking industry and the safety of ourhighways.

PENNSYLVANIA IRP
IRP Pennsylvania Registration. Applying for an IRP plate involves several steps. You must determine whether you need a USDOT number and HVUT permit. Also, all truckers are required to register with the IFTA (International Fuel Tax Agreement). A list of USDOT, HVUT, and other requirements are in the Pennsylvania DMV website.
